Bernadette Scarduzio is a fellow CMT'er who has made it her mission to raise awareness about CMT. "Bernadette" is a film that offers the world a view into the challenges and difficulties of living with Charcot-Marie-Tooth disease. Filmed over four years, audiences are invited to join Bernadette’s journey and her transformation from patient to advocate. Bernadette and filmmaker Josh Taub intend to make CMT “a household word,” elevating the cause to a national and international level, hopefully paving the way for more research funding and ultimately a cure.
